Name one example of a mixture and one example of a solution.
Mixtures: Fruit salad, cereal and milk, trail mix, water and gravel (other answers may be accepted).
Solutions: Salt/sugar and water, coffee and sugar, koolaid and water, tea and water (other answers may be accepted).
Name one example of a physical change and one example of a chemical reaction.
Physical Change: Breaking a piggy bank, smashing a window, tearing a paper, changing state (other answers may be accepted).
Chemical Reaction: Burning paper, fireworks, mentos and coke, baking a cake (other answers may be accepted).

In a solution of coffee and sugar, describe which substance would be the solute and which would be the solvent.
Sugar- Solute
Coffee- Solvent
Is ice melting a chemical or physical change? Why?
It is a physical change because a new substance is not being created. Ice is just frozen water. When it melts, it is still water.
Describe the major difference between a solid and a liquid.
A solid has a definite shape, but a liquid takes the shape of the container it's in.

Why is chocolate milk both a mixture and a solution?
Mixture- It is 2 substances combined together
Solution- The chocolate dissolves and spreads evenly among the milk.
Name 6 possible characteristics of a chemical reaction.
Change in color, the release of heat, the release of light, the release of gas, change in shape, change in smell (other answers may be accepted).
